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5719 702010404 008 3325151 8015335
1383708486 297 267959855
1383708486 297 267959855
8551916 870726766 741 8133
All about undefined
Interested in learning more?
1383708486 297 267959855
8551916 870726766 741 8133
See more
926 8822
93 1009855 06 436250616
See more
60943808 99 85325028
05 13710 66181 134826729 9481204
See more